Fintech growth is moving into a more mature phase where commercial value, customer adoption, and sustainable business models are becoming the focus. Digital payments, embedded finance, lending platforms, and wealth technology continue to create opportunities, but companies need clear market visibility to identify where growth can translate into long-term value.
According to KPMG’s Pulse of Fintech report, global fintech investment reached $95.4 billion across 4,547 deals in 2023, showing continued interest in financial technology despite a more selective investment environment.
For fintech companies, banks, and investors, understanding market potential requires a detailed view of demand, competition, regulations, and scalability. A Fintech market assessment helps organizations evaluate where opportunities exist and how they can build stronger strategies.
